What Do We Have In Common As I'Ve Hit Rock Bottom

I wanted to talk--my life has hit "rock bottom." You said; "No...we've nothing in common." I thought we did...we both go to the same church. For some fellowship, I'll begin a new search. Many Sundays... My voice goes unheard. While in your hand, you were carrying God's word. Are there others who'd spend a minute of their time? Or am I just a shadow whom they would leave behind? I thought the blood of Jesus was our common thread. What are we doing here? Are we spiritually dead? I hope that with me, you won't just "push aside." Wasn't it also for me--that our saviour died? You meet different people every day. How do you react to others whom God brings your way? May God's Holy spirit convict you to spend Your time with others-- not just those you call "friend." Being Christ' s example is truly a blessing indeed. Reaching out to the hurting--those in need. This is where Christianity really starts. When we reach out to the hurting and broken hearts. By Jim Pemberton
